CHAPTER 10
IT WAS ALONG toward evening when Rowdy came.
Lark, sitting in the rocking chair close by the cookstove, with a quilt-bundled Lydia sleeping in her lap, knew it was him by the way he knocked.
Mrs. Porter had gone to bed, worn-out from the long night just past and the wearying day that followed. Mai Lee was off somewhere, probably helping Hon Sing with saloon duties neglected during the crisis with Lydia.
“Come in,” Lark called.
Rowdy opened the door and stepped over the threshold, Pardner with him. And Lark saw the grim tidings in his face, even before he voiced them.
“How is she?” he asked, nodding to indicate Lydia, as he hung up his hat.
“Weak,” Lark said, “but she’ll recover, thanks to Hon Sing.”
Rowdy took off his gloves, stuffed them into a pocket in his coat, shed the garment, and laid it over the back of one of the chairs at the kitchen table.
“What about you, Lark?” he asked, very quietly, stopping at a little distance and watching her with eyes that would see right through any lie she told. “You look pretty done in yourself. Have you had anything to eat? Slept a little, maybe?”
She managed a thin smile, shook her head. Waited.
“Well,” he said philosophically, “neither have I.”
“Rowdy,” Lark said.
“No,” he sighed, gazing down at Lydia’s still, sleeping form. “The doctor didn’t make it home.”
Lark closed her eyes, held Lydia a little more tightly. “Where is the—where is he now?”
“At the undertaker’s,” Rowdy answered. “I took him to his house first, but Mrs. Fairmont didn’t want him laid out there.” He sighed again. “I reckon I can’t blame her.”
“You’ve gathered, I suppose, that Mabel Fairmont isn’t the most dedicated mother?” Lark’s eyes burned. What was Lydia going to do? Was there a family somewhere—grandparents, perhaps, or aunts and uncles? Anyone who might take her in?
“I gathered that much, all right,” Rowdy said.
Pardner, sitting as close to Lark’s chair as he could without being in her lap, gazed mournfully at Lydia. Nuzzled her cheek with his snout.
Lydia stirred, smiled a little, tried to stroke the dog’s head. Murmured a greeting.
Meanwhile, Rowdy went to the sink, rolled up his shirtsleeves and pumped water to wash his hands. That finished, he headed for the pantry and came out with a bowl of eggs and a loaf of bread.
“Supper,” he explained.
Supper. Lark was reminded of the plans she’d made with Maddie, to visit the O’Ballivan ranch on Friday. Though she had barely a hope of getting there, it made her feel a little better to imagine being a guest at Sam and Maddie’s table, speaking of pleasant things. After the meal was over, Maddie might even be persuaded to play the spinet.
Lark ached for music.
Rowdy cracked four eggs into a bowl, whipped them to a froth with a fork and set a skillet on the stove to heat. The lard he added smelled good as it melted.
“Do you think there’s more snow coming?” Lark asked with a note of dread in her voice, starting to come out of her stupor.
